Newly elected council votes to stop work on NZ$100m harbour redevelopment project

A plan to develop a new marine leisure centre at Ōpōtiki Harbour, located on New Zealand’s North Island in the Bay of Plenty, southeast of Tauranga, has been put of hold following the election of a new council.
